How Long Do Hard Inquiries Stay on Your Credit Report? – Any inquiry made on your credit status is classified as ‘hard’ when you shop for mortgage loans, student loans, auto loans, and new credit cards. hard inquiries can stay on your credit report for 24 months (2 years). However, after 12 months, it will no longer affect your credit score. Perhaps.

Too Many Credit Inquiries on Your Credit Report? Here's What. – Whenever you check your credit report, you’ll find a section titled "Credit Inquiries" or "Regular Inquiries." These inquiries are made by organizations that pulled your credit report – and they can remain on your report for up to two years.
